Monthly Rate Conversion Date definition

Monthly Rate Conversion Date means the day on which the Bonds are converted to bear interest at a Monthly Rate pursuant to Section 3.02(g) or (h).
Monthly Rate Conversion Date means the day on which interest on the 2010 Bonds of a Series begins to accrue at a Monthly Rate for such Series following conversion from a different Variable Rate pursuant to Section 2.03(h).
Monthly Rate Conversion Date means any date on which the Notes are converted to Notes bearing interest at the Monthly Rate, which must be the first day of any calendar month.

Examples of Monthly Rate Conversion Date in a sentence

  • Whenever a Series of 2010 Bonds is to bear interest at a Monthly Rate, the Monthly Rate Periods shall commence on the Monthly Rate Conversion Date, which shall be the first Business Day of a calendar month, subject to the provisions of subsection (h) of this Section, and end on the day immediately preceding the first Business Day of the next calendar month.
